Everest Metals’ Rover project is set to be hit with the drillbit this week when Rio Tinto Exploration kicks off a seven-hole, 1400m reverse-circulation (RC) program. The new campaign will target potential pegmatite-hosted lithium mineralisation beneath weathered outcrop at the project’s northernmost tenement in the Central Yilgarn region of Western Australia – an area undergoing a resurgence in exploration.
